Benefits and Drawbacks of a 35 Loan a 35-Year Mortgage
Taking out capital for your residence can be a significant decision . A 35-year loan offers several advantages , such as lower monthly payments . This makes it significantly simpler for individuals to obtain their desired property. However, a 35-year loan also comes with potential downsides . A significant consideration is the overall interest paid , which can be large over such an extended period . Additionally, a lengthy financing schedule may limit your financial flexibility in other areas.
- Weighing the pros and cons carefully before choosing a loan is crucial.
Distinct Financing Options to Consider Instead of a 35 Loan
If the conventional route of securing a 35 loan feels restrictive or unattainable, you're not alone. A plethora of innovative financing options are available to explore, catering to diverse financial situations and goals. Consider alternatives like peer-to-peer lending platforms, which connect borrowers directly with individual investors, often at favorable interest rates. Factoring companies can provide immediate cash flow by purchasing your outstanding invoices at a discount. For businesses, crowdfunding campaigns can tap into the collective support of a passionate audience to fuel growth. Before committing to a traditional loan, it's essential to research these alternative paths and determine which best aligns with your needs and circumstances.
